What
The monthly OMRSCCA Board of Directors meeting is every first Tuesday of the month at 7:00 PM. They're a casual open meeting for members and non-members alike, and everyone is welcome to hear and be heard. Have a burger, talk club business, and bench race until you want to go home.
When
Tuesday, September 7th, 7:00 PM
Where
Schultz & Dooley's Too (pub/bar/restaurant)
3512 S National Avenue, Springfield
[Google Maps]
Basically, go North a few blocks off the National exit on the James River Freeway, and it will be in a brown brick shopping center on your right.
